The size of Sunnybank is approximately 4.7 square kilometres. It has 18 parks covering nearly 17.0% of total area. The population of Sunnybank in 2016 was 8697 people. By 2021 the population was 8892 showing a population growth of 2.2%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Sunnybank is 20-29 years. Households in Sunnybank are primarily couples with children and are likely to be repaying $1800 - $2399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Sunnybank work in a professional occupation.In 2021, 56.30% of the homes in Sunnybank were owner-occupied compared with 60.20% in 2016.
